What is a Stool Culture?

A stool culture is a laboratory test used to identify bacteria, viruses and parasites in a sample of stool (feces).

Why would I get a Stool Culture?

A stool culture is typically ordered when an individual is experiencing digestive symptoms such as diarrhea, abdominal pain, bloating, or constipation. This test can help diagnose a number of infections and other medical conditions such as irritable bowel syndrome and celiac disease.

What happens during a Stool Culture?

A stool culture procedure involves collecting a sample of stool, usually with a swab or cup, and then testing it in a lab to look for potential infections.
